WebMay 14, 2024 · Calathea Warscewiczii Plant Care. Calathea Warscewiczii does best in rich, fertile, well-draining potting soil. The soil where you plant it should be moist all the time. The plant enjoys a bright spot but does not want full sun. Temperatures should be between 65°F to 85°F (18°C to 29°C). WebJan 25, 2024 · Calathea plants that get rootbound invite fungal infections that will kill the plant. Increase the size of the container an inch or two each time. If you tend to overwater your plants, get an unglazed terra-cotta pot since it’s porous and allows water to evaporate through the walls.

Remember that a Calathea’s praying motion is accomplished by shifting moisture in and out of the pulvini below its leaves. If the plant doesn’t have enough water to spare, it won’t be able to move. Other symptoms of dehydration include drooping, shriveled, or crispy leaves.

WebDec 12, 2024 · Calathea roseopicta ‘Medallion’. Characterized for having large, oval, and patterned leaves, the Calathea medallion is another plant for keeps. On top of each dark-colored leaf is a light green border or outline while the center has a feather-like pattern. Listed … the parapod movieWebJun 16, 2024 · Calathea rattlesnake plants originated from Brazil and can grow up to 30” tall. One unique feature of Calathea rattlesnake plants is their beautifully marked leaves with wavy edges and green spots.
